During the Soup-at-Home days, you'll bring soup and visit our elderly. Your smile and visit make a world of difference!

What does a Soup-at-home day entail?

The Soup-at-Home Days are held weekly at a fixed time and last approximately 2-3 hours. We'll meet you at the designated starting time at the distribution point. Upon arrival, we'll give you a warm welcome and explain everything about the program. You'll visit the elderly at home with a fresh soup and provide company. The elderly will often invite you to join them for a cup of coffee, a walk, or to do something together. All the information will be provided a few days before the event.


Why do we organize Soup-at-home days?

With our Soup-at-Home Days, we reach the elderly who need company the most. Through local GPs, physiotherapists, your local supermarket, and many other supporters, we reach a large group of vulnerable elderly people. Your smile, friendly chat, or brief moment of connection can make a world of difference for our elderly.

About Oma's Soep - Wageningen

Oma's Soep sells delicious fresh soups and meals based on grandma's authentic recipe. The proceeds are used to make lonely elderly people happy! At least 50% of the profits from Oma's Soep are donated to the Oma's Soep Foundation. The Foundation organizes weekly activities in various cities throughout the country where young and old are brought together to combat loneliness. Locally, our student boards organize weekly Cooking Days and Soup-at-home days and nationally we organize major events and PR campaigns.
